Explore the dynamic and in-demand field of Cloud Platform Engineering, a critical role at the heart of modern digital business. For those seeking Cloud Platform Engineer jobs, this profession offers a unique opportunity to build and maintain the foundational platforms that power entire organizations. Unlike roles focused on a single application, Cloud Platform Engineers are the architects of the internal developer platform—the underlying infrastructure, tools, and services that enable other software engineers to build, deploy, and scale applications efficiently and securely. Professionals in this role are responsible for designing, implementing, and managing robust, scalable, and secure cloud infrastructure. A typical day involves writing infrastructure as code (IaC) using tools like Terraform or CloudFormation to automate the provisioning of resources. They build and maintain continuous integration and continuous deployment (CI/CD) pipelines to streamline software delivery. A core responsibility is ensuring the platform's reliability and performance by implementing comprehensive monitoring, logging, and observability solutions. Security is paramount; these engineers embed security controls and best practices directly into the platform, a concept known as "security by design," to protect data and applications from threats. The skill set for a Cloud Platform Engineer is both broad and deep. Proficiency in at least one major cloud provider—such as A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ud Platform—is essential, with many roles requiring multi-cloud expertise. Strong programming and scripting skills in languages like Python, Go, or Java are necessary for automation and tool development. A deep understanding of containerization technologies like Docker and orchestration platforms like Kubernetes is standard. These professionals must also be well-versed in networking concepts, identity and access management (IAM), and cloud security principles. Beyond technical prowess, successful platform engineers possess strong problem-solving abilities, a collaborative mindset to work with development teams, and a passion for creating efficient, self-service systems. Typical requirements for Cloud Platform Engineer jobs often include several years of hands-on experience in cloud environments, a proven track record of building and automating infrastructure, and a background in software development or systems administration. As companies continue their rapid adoption of cloud technologies, the demand for skilled engineers who can construct these internal platforms is soaring.
